The green happiness' beet burgers
Vegan burger of beets, onion, garlic, ras el hanout and chickpeas on spelled bread with cucumber, hummus and sprouts.

Directions
-
Preheat the oven to 190 ° C.
-
Grate the beets with a coarse grater. Slice the onions and garlic.
-
Heat the olive oil in a frying pan and fry the onions and garlic for about 3 minutes until they are glazed.
-
Rub the ras el hanout with a mortar if necessary. Add the beets and ras el hanout to the onions and fry for about 6 minutes on medium heat.
-
Let the chickpeas drain, I do a bowl and puree with a hand blender.
-
Spoon the beet mixture through the chickpeas and mix thoroughly. Season with pepper and salt.
-
Prepare a burger per person of the mixture with wet hands, press well and spread over a baking sheet covered with parchment paper.
-
Bake the burgers for 15 minutes in the middle of the oven. Turn around and cook for another 15 minutes.
-
Meanwhile, cut the cucumber into slant slices and mix the sprout vegetables together.
-
Cut the bread into a thick slice of approx. 2.5 cm per person. Halve that slices in width so that you have 2 slices per person.
-
Spread each slice of bread with 1 tbsp hummus and spread the sprouts, burgers and cucumbers over half of the buns and cover with the rest of the buns.
